An Operations Executive) Preferably (F) Hospitality Services- drives revenue and profitability by managing and expanding a portfolio of top-tier corporate clients, hotel chains, or institutional partners. They act as the strategic link between the client and internal teams, ensuring tailored solutions, high retention rates, and long-term business growth.]A comprehensive job profile breakdown for this role includes the following core areas: Core Responsibilities
- Relationship Management: Develop, nurture, and maintain long-term, high-trust relationships with key clients and decision-makers.
- Revenue & Sales Growth: Identify opportunities for upselling and cross-selling (e.g., event spaces, corporate packages, F&B services) to maximize account profitability.
- Contract Negotiation: Lead commercial negotiations, including pricing, service level agreements (SLAs), and contract renewals.
- Cross-Functional Collaboration: Act as the primary liaison between the client and internal departments (e.g., operations, marketing, revenue management) to ensure flawless service delivery. [
- Market Analysis: Monitor industry trends, competitor activities, and client feedback to anticipate needs and adapt account strategies.
Key Performance Indicators (KPIs)
- Account revenue growth and retention rates.
- Customer Satisfaction (CSAT) and Net Promoter Score (NPS).
- Volume of upselling and new contracts closed.
Essential Qualifications & Skills
- Experience: 2–4 years in B2B sales, account management, or business development within the hospitality or service sector.
- Commercial Acumen: Strong financial understanding, including forecasting, budgeting, and pricing strategies.
- Soft Skills: Exceptional negotiation, communication, conflict resolution, and relationship-building abilities.
